Yield: 4 Servings
Measure | Ingredient |
---|---|
8 ounces | Bow Ties or Radiatore OR other medium pasta shape, uncooked |
4 ounces | Fresh snow peas washed and trimmed |
2 \N | Red bell peppers ribs and seeds removed, cut in strips |
4 \N | Scallions; thinly sliced |
3 cups | Fresh broccoli florets |
2 cups | Diced cooked chicken |
1 tablespoon | Sesame oil |
1 tablespoon | Peanut oil |
2 tablespoons | Red wine vinegar |
½ teaspoon | Hot sauce |
2 teaspoons | Honey |
½ teaspoon | Garlic powder |
½ teaspoon | Ground ginger |
3 tablespoons | Sesame seeds |
\N \N | Salt and pepper to taste |
Cook pasta according to package directions; drain and cool. Add the snow peas, red pepper, scallions, broccoli and diced chicken. Combine remaining ingredients and pour the dressing over the pasta mixture.
Toss lightly. Cover and chill.
Note: Diced turkey or water-packed tuna may be substituted for the cooked chicken.
Each serving provides: 598 Calories; 37.7 g Protein; 77 g Carbohydrates; 15.7 g Fat; 59½ mg Cholesterol; 84 mg Sodium.
Calories from Fat: 24%
